Output 81ee9a5003c69d39c166d188f6b6042c88ca12c44ad7a034dd1b70dfb3512cdc:2

value
1000907
script pubkey
OP_0 OP_PUSHBYTES_20 08b2a7b9b21977e172e2bc6244d2de3a2a6ed95a
address
bc1qpze20wdjr9m7zuhzh33yf5k78g4xak269g5uwj
transaction
81ee9a5003c69d39c166d188f6b6042c88ca12c44ad7a034dd1b70dfb3512cdc
confirmations
270085
spent
true